Description
The Evening Primrose is a drought tolerant perennial producing an abundant supply of fragrant 2″ pink flowers, which open in the evening. This plant grows 6″ to 12″ in height and has a 24″ to 30″ spread.

Plant Type | Ground Cover |
---|---|
Origin | Mexico, Texas |
Size (H x W) | 12" x 3' |
Sun | Full Sun |
Water | Low |
Flower Color | Pink |
Flower Season | Spring through Fall |
